Bug Description

When testing the camera-app on the Nexus 7, I noticed that it does not properly support the Nexus 7. The camera selection logic appears like it doesn't support a device that only has a front-facing camera. I took a quick look at fixing this thinking it was only the camera selection logic, but it seems there's more than just this wrong with it on the Nexus 7.

Steps to reproduce:
1. Open the Camera application
2. The preview window stays grayed out and cannot take a photo.
3. Press the switch camera button.
4. The preview window remains grayed out and still cannot take a photo.

Expected behavior:
To be able to view a live video preview from the front camera and take a still image of it.
